Husband, 84, and wife, 80, die holding hands on the same day after being married for 59 years

A couple who were married 59 years died last month holding hands in their shared hospital room.

Don and Margaret Livengood, ages 84 and 80, charmed the workers at Carolinas Healthcare NorthEast, so someone pulled strings to let the ailing husband and wife share their last days together in the same room.



Nurses positioned the couple's beds to face each other, so that they were holding hands as Margaret passed just before 8am on August 19. 


That afternoon at 5.19pm, her husband followed her in death, telling his children and grandchildren before he died that he was looking forward to joining his wife in heaven. 

'When we get to heaven, we can walk in together, just like we're getting married again. Another honeymoon,' Don said, according to his daughter Pattie Livengood Beaver, who spoke with People.

Beaver and her husband moved in with her parents last year, when both became sick. Her father had pulmonary fibrosis and bilateral pneumonia when he died, while her mother was diagnosed with cancer in May and had several other serious health issues.
